10th Annual Baton Rouge Mardi Gras Festival

Add to calendar
Share:

Join us for the Mardi Gras Celebration of Life Together with Great Music, Delicious Food and Dancing with Family & Friends!

Date: Saturday, February 18, 2023

Time: 10:00 AM - 7:00 PM

Place: Galvez Plaza & Stage in Downtown Baton Rouge
200 - 238 North Boulevard | Baton Rouge, LA 70801
Across from North Boulevard Town Square. Between the new River Center Branch Library and the Rhorer Plaza (behind City Hall). The Galvez Stage is the Crest sculpture

Featuring continuous live music in various genres, a Vendor’s Village and Food Court filled with festival food favorites, slanted toward this annual holiday celebration. Lawn seating, so bring your chairs, families, friends and your smiles.

  • FREE and Open to the Public - Family Friendly
  • VIP packages have preferred seating are $50.00 and include 2 meal tickets for the 'Taste of Louisiana' VIP tent, 2 non-alcoholic drink tickets, a CD of "Now" by Henry Turner Jr. & Flavor and additional giveaways.
  • Big Chief Packages are $100 and include 4 meal and drink tickets for two people, a CD of "Now" by Henry Turner Jr. & Flavor, covered seating, photo ops and additional giveaways.

Note: The Crest sculpture (also known as Galvez Stage) is a progressive symbol of Baton Rouge's surge of continuous growth and developments today and tomorrow. Its namesake and form symbolizes our legendary music, cuisine, the Mississippi River and the character of our local residents.

We are strong, resilient and know how to enjoy the celebration of life together with music, food and libations.
